5.4 VOICE MODULATION.
The source of this modulation is selectable from either the filter's contour generator or the third os-
cillator. These affect each voice independently. Voice Modulation is independent of the LFO Modu-
lation (5.0).
5.5 OSC 3.
Controls the amount of modulation from oscil-
lator 3.
5.6 FILTER CONTOUR.
Controls the amount of modulation from the
filter's contour generator.
5.7 CONTOURED OSC 3 AMOUNT.
When switched on allows the filter's contour
generator to shape the amount of modulation
coming from oscillator three. This is useful for
creating modulation effects that vary with
time.
5.8 INVERT.
Inverts the filter contour as it's applied to the
CONTOURED OSC 3 AMOUNT (5.7) and
inverts the output of OSC 3 (6.0).
5.9 DESTINATION SWITCHES.
Voice Modulation can be routed to five places
using this set of switches: the frequency of os-
cillator 1 (OSC 1 FREQ), the frequency of os-
cillator 2 (OSC 2 FREQ), the pulse width of
oscillator 1 (PW 1), the pulse width of oscilla-
tor 2 (PW 2), and/or the filter's cutoff fre-
quency (FILTER).
